### sec.41 Approval to give entry notices by publication
A resource authority holder may apply to the chief executive for approval to give an entry notice by publishing it in a stated way.
The application may relate to more than 1 entry notice or a particular type of entry.
The chief executive may give the approval only if satisfied—
the publication will happen at least 20 business days before the entry; and
for an owner or occupier who is an individual—it is impracticable to give the owner or occupier the notice personally.
Chapter 6 , part 1 applies for processing the application, and the chief executive must decide to either refuse to give the approval or give the approval with or without conditions.
